300+ câu trắc nghiệm Phát triển ứng dụng với PHP và MySQL có đáp án - Phần 6
25 câu hỏi
php
<?php
$fruits = array(
"apple",
"mango",
"peach",
"pear",
"orange"
);
$subset = array_slice($fruits, 2);
print_r($subset);
?>
Kết quả của đoạn code dưới đây là?
Array ( [0] => peach )
Array ( [0] => apple [1] => mango [2] => peach )
Array ( [0] => apple [1] => mango )
Array ( [0] => peach [1] => pear [2] => orange )
php
<?php
$number = array(
"4",
"hello",
2
);
echo (array_sum($number));
?>
Kết quả của đoạn code dưới đây là?
4hello2
4
2
6
php
<?php
$a = array(
12,
5,
2
);
echo (array_product($a));
?>
Kết quả của đoạn code dưới đây là?
024
120
010
060
php
<?php
$people = array(
"Peter",
"Susan",
"Edmund",
"Lucy"
);
echo pos($people);
?>
Kết quả của đoạn code dưới đây là?
Lucy
Peter
Susan
Edmund
php
<?php
define("GREETING", "Hello you! How are you today?");
echo constant("GREETING");
?>
Kết quả của đoạn code dưới đây là?
Hello you! How are you today?
GREETING
GREETING, Hello you! How are you today?
“GREETING”,”Hello you! How are you today?”
php
<?php
echo stripos("I love php, I love php too!", "PHP");
?>
Kết quả của đoạn code dưới đây là?
3
7
8
10
php
<?php
function mine($m)
{
if ($m < 0) echo "less than 0";
if ($m >= 0) echo "Not True";
}
mine(0);
?>
Kết quả của đoạn code dưới đây là?
less than 0
Not True
Không ra kết quả
Tất cả đều sai
php
<?php
function 2myfunc()
{
echo "Hello World";
}
2myfunc();
?>
Câu này sẽ báo lỗi vì tên hàm không được bắt đầu bằng số.
Hello World
Không có kết quả
Có lỗi xảy ra
Tất cả đều sai
<?php
function _func()
{
echo "Hello World";
}
_func();
?>
Hello World
Không có kết quả
Có lỗi xảy ra
Tất cả đều sai
<?php
function mine($num)
{
$num = 2 + $num;
echo $num;
}
mine(3);
?>
3
$num
5
Tất cả đều sai
<?php
function one($string)
{
echo "I am " . $String;
}
one("Batman");
?>
I am Batman
I am
Batman
Có lỗi xảy ra
<?php
function colour()
{
$colors = array(
"red",
"green",
"blue",
"yellow"
);
foreach ($colors as $value)
{
echo "$value " . ",";
}
}
colour();
?>
red,green,blue,yellow,
green,blue,yellow,red
red,blue,yellow,green
red,green,yellow,blue
<?php
Function
case ()
{
echo "Hello World! ";
echo "Hello World! ";
echo "Hello World! ";
}
case ();
?>
Hello World!
Hello World! Hello World!
Hello World! Hello World! Hello World!
Tất cả đều sai
<?php
function email()
{
$email = ’user@yahoo . com’;
$new = strstr($email, ‘@');
echo $new;
}
email();
?>
user
user@yahoo.com
@yahoo.com
yahoo.com
<?php
$x = 0;
if ($x) print "hi";
else print "how are u";
?>
how are u
hi
Error
No output
<?php
$x = 0;
if ($x == 0) print "hi";
else print "how are u";
print "hello"
?>
how are uhello
hihello
hi
No output
<?php
$x = 0;
if ($x == 1) if ($x >= 0) print "true";
else print "false";
?>
true
false
error
Không có kết quả in ra
<?php
$a = 1;
if (echo $a) print "True";
else print "False";
?>
true
false
Xảy ra lỗi
Không có kết quả trả về
<?php
$a = 1;
if (print $a) print "True";
else print "False";
?>
1True
False
Có lỗi xảy ra
Màn hình trắng
Tính đóng gói trong OOP là
Polymorphism
Inheritance
Encapsulation
Abstraction
Tính đa hình trong OOP là
Abstraction
Polymorphism
Inheritance
Differential
Tính kế thừa trong OOP là
Polymorphism
Inheritance
Encapsulation
Abstraction
Từ khóa sau đây không được hỗ trợ bởi PHP
friendly
final
public
static
Dòng nào để khởi tạo một đối tượng thuộc lớp có tên foo trong PHP
$obj = new $foo;
$obj = new foo;
$obj = new foo ();
obj = new foo ();
Dòng nào để định nghĩa hằng số PI trong PHP
constant PI = “3.1415”;
const $PI = “3.1415”;
constant PI = ‘3.1415’;
const PI = ‘3.1415’;








